The Role of App Center Alternatives in Enhancing Software Quality.

The Role of App Center Alternatives in Enhancing Software Quality.

Finding the right platform for developing, testing, and managing mobile applications is crucial for any software development team. While Microsoft's App Center has been a popular choice, exploring alternatives can offer unique benefits tailored to specific project needs. Whether it's flexibility in configuration, better integration capabilities, or support for a wider range of platforms, choosing the right tool can significantly impact the development process.

Many alternatives to App Center provide greater flexibility in customizing workflows to better suit specific project requirements. This is particularly beneficial for projects that require unique configurations not supported by more generalized solutions. Being able to tailor the environment exactly to a team's needs can lead to more efficient workflows and improved productivity.

Some alternatives to App Center may offer better integration with a broader array of tools and services, which can streamline development processes significantly. This includes more seamless connectivity with version control systems, project management tools, and other software development kits that are essential for a smooth workflow. This integration helps in reducing friction and improving the continuity between different stages of development.

Unlike some application centers that might focus more on specific ecosystems like iOS or Android, other alternatives often provide more comprehensive support for multiple platforms including Windows, web, and even custom operating systems. This is crucial for teams working on cross-platform applications who need to ensure consistent functionality and performance across all devices and platforms.

An open-source automation server that allows developers to build, test, and deploy their software. Jenkins is highly customizable with thousands of plugins, making it adaptable to almost any kind of project. It supports continuous integration and continuous delivery (CI/CD) practices, which are essential for modern software development methodologies.

A popular CI service that is well integrated with GitHub, making it a favorite for projects hosted there. Travis CI is easy to set up and provides support for multiple languages and platforms, streamlining the testing and deployment processes significantly.

Combines source code management and CI/CD into a single application. This integration provides a comprehensive overview of the entire development cycle, making it easier for teams to track progress and issues. It's particularly useful for larger teams looking to maintain tight integration between code changes and deployment.

Reference text about Developer tools

Exploring alternatives to App Center can open up new opportunities to enhance development workflows, improve integration, and support a broader range of platforms. Each tool has its own set of features and capabilities, and the choice should be based on the specific needs of the project and team. By adopting a tool that aligns closely with their workflow requirements, development teams can achieve higher efficiency, better performance, and ultimately deliver higher quality software products.